MIDI is the note number synths and software pass around (0–127). Pitch class is the note without its octave — all the C♯s share one. Enharmonic spellings (C♯5 and D♭5) name the same pitch two ways.

At other reference pitches

Reference (A4)C♯5 frequencyWhere you meet it
432 Hz544.286 Hzthe alternative-tuning circle
440 Hzstandard554.365 Hzthe ISO 16 standard — concert pitch
442 Hz556.885 Hzmany European orchestras tune a touch sharp
443 Hz558.145 Hzsome sharper continental orchestras

Every row is C♯5 — only the A4 you tune to changes. A frequency scales straight with the reference: C♯5 at 432 Hz is the 440 Hz value times 432⁄440.
